Early this morning as heavy rainfall and storms rolled through the area, the volunteers of the Plymouth Fire Company No. 1 (Montco 43) were dispatched at 02:07 hours to Mile marker 19.2 S/B on Route I-476 for a vehicle accident with reported injuries. Initial 911 callers reported a tractor trailer had left the roadway colliding into the trees and over the guardrail.

Chief 43 responded just after dispatch and was updated with reports of the driver of the tractor trailer was entrapped. The incident was then upgraded to an Accident with entrapment.

Chief 43 arrived confirming the driver to be confined in the cab with trees and brush on top of and pressed into the driver's compartment. Squad 43 with a crew of 3 arrived and went into service with saws and spreaders to clear debris and pop the driver's side door open freeing the confined operator.

Command marked the rescue complete within 10 minutes and the operator was transferred to the care of awaiting EMS. Squirt 43 and Traffic 43 responded and assisted with traffic control and lane blocking. The incident was turned over to PA State Police and station 43 was clear and available just after 02:30 hours.
